The Balboa Pavilion is a historic landmark located in the charming coastal city of Newport Beach. This iconic building has been a staple of the community since it was first constructed in 1906, and it has served as a hub for entertainment, dining, and recreation for over a century.

The Pavilion boasts a stunning Mediterranean-style architecture, complete with red-tiled roofs, stucco walls, and arched doorways. Its grand entrance leads visitors into a spacious arcade area, which is lined with a variety of shops, restaurants, and attractions. From here, guests can take in panoramic views of the nearby harbor and beach, or they can head out onto the adjacent boardwalk to soak up the sun and sea breeze.

Inside the Pavilion, visitors can find a range of activities to suit their interests. The lower level houses a large ballroom, which has hosted countless dances, concerts, and events over the years. The upper level features a restaurant and bar, where guests can enjoy delicious food and drinks while taking in the stunning views of the ocean and harbor.

For those looking for outdoor fun, the Pavilion offers a variety of water activities, including boat rentals, fishing charters, and harbor cruises. Visitors can also rent bicycles or surreys to explore the surrounding area, or they can take a leisurely stroll along the beach or boardwalk.
